The Dell Quick Start project in Mississauga is a repurposing of a former plastics manufacturing facility. The interior of the building was completely demolished and then rebuilt as a state-of-the-art data centre.

Mechanical Systems

Among other mechanical duties, Kelson was responsible for the fabrication and installation of a glycol cooling system to service the large Computer Room Air Conditioning (CRAC) units that keep the servers and mainframe computers within operating temperatures. The mechanical scope included the following:

  • Install HVAC system for the building, including three separate air-handling units
  • Fit out the mechanical room, installing two 185-ton water chillers and one 180-ton dry cooler
  • Provide all piping required for the various mechanical components of the building
